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Kafue National Park's airport?
Kafue National Park has only one airport, Kenneth Kaunda Intl. Airport (LUN).
How many airlines fly to Kafue National Park?
Kafue National Park is serviced by 13 air carriers from 13 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Kafue National Park?
Kafue National Park receives the largest number of flights from Proflight Zambia, Airlink and South African Airways with Proflight Zambia being the favourite choice of carrier. Johannesburg is the most popular city for travellers to depart from.
How many nonstop flights are there to Kafue National Park?
Flying to a new place is much simpler when there aren't any annoying stopovers. If you're off to Kafue National Park, the awesome news is that there are approximately 182 direct flights operating every week.
Where are the most popular flights to Kafue National Park departing from?
Flights to Kafue National Park departing from Johannesburg, Ndola and Harare airports are always popular.
How long is the flight to Kafue National Park Airport?
If it's Johannesburg you're departing, you'll be midair for around 2 hours and 1 minute before you touchdown in Kafue National Park. Tarmac to tarmac from Ndola generally takes 46 minutes and from Harare, the average flight time is 1 hour and 2 minutes.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Kafue National Park?
The secret is to be organised before you get to the airport security gate. That way, you'll be boarding that plane to Kafue National Park in no time flat. Follow these helpful tips and get your holiday off to a spectacular start:

  • Your passport and boarding pass will need to be presented to airport security personnel. Have them close by so you don't hold up the line.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y coats or jackets.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your phone and tablet, will also need to be separately scanned.
  • Remember to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it in a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you valuable min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Lightweight sneakers are usually not.
  • Pocket knives and other sharp items are not allowed on board. They'll be confiscated at security, so put them in your checked baggage.
